Abstract
A new heuristic search approach for scheduling two classes of flexible manufacturing systems (FMSs) that contains assembly operations is proposed. The FMSs are modeled by two classes of Petri nets, called generalized symmetric and asymmetric nets. In the paper, the problem of minimizing makespan is transformed into searching the reachability graph for the optimal (minimal time) firing sequence from the initial marking (state) to the goal marking. A solution of the state equation constitutes a part of the heuristic function. The dynamic information of the nets, such as concurrency and synchronization, is used to adjust the heuristic function since the solution of the state equation may over-estimate the real cost
